Shin Splints / Medial Tibial Stress Syndrome

    Medial tibial stress syndrome, commonly called shin splints, is pain along the inner edge of the shin caused by overload of the tibia and surrounding tissues, typically seen with running or repetitive impact.

    Common Symptoms

    • Aching or sharp pain along the inner edge of the shin
    • Pain that warms up but returns or worsens later in a run
    • Tenderness along a diffuse area of the tibia rather than a single point
    • Symptoms that often build over consecutive training sessions
    • Discomfort with jumping, cutting, or other repetitive impact

    A single, sharply tender point on the bone, especially with pain at night, can suggest a stress fracture and warrants medical evaluation.

    What May Contribute

    Shin splints reflect a mismatch between cumulative impact load and what the bone and surrounding tissues are prepared for.

    • Rapid increases in running mileage, intensity, or hill work
    • Changes in footwear or running surface
    • Reduced calf and posterior tibialis capacity for repeated impact
    • Previous shin pain that was not fully resolved
    • Periods of low loading followed by aggressive return

    Treatment Options May Include

    • Education about load, recovery, and how to progress safely
    • Adjustments to running volume, intensity, or surface during the early phase
    • Progressive strength work for the calf, foot, and hip
    • Soft-tissue work for the tibialis posterior, soleus, and surrounding calf complex
    • Footwear or surface input when clearly relevant
    • Coordination with a physician if a stress reaction or fracture is suspected

    How This Condition Is Commonly Diagnosed

    Diagnosis is clinical, with imaging used to rule out stress fracture when the picture is concerning.

    • History of training pattern and symptom behavior
    • Palpation along the medial tibia and surrounding tissues
    • Single-leg hop and load testing
    • Imaging when a stress fracture is suspected

    Expected Recovery and Prognosis

    Most cases improve within several weeks of a load reset and structured conditioning, with return to full training built around progressive loading.

    Long-term prevention is built around consistent strength work, smart training progression, and respecting the early signs of overload.
